Output 66ebc4d250c999c1d1de595a31456bc84e9d1530c472933fb3c8519ba1151ba5:125

value
98917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de7b8cb28f3a3941078154154fc43c5be3e6a8e OP_EQUAL
address
3EdLnudZYgvF9f4et7ra3ZvikpubMLHkm1
transaction
66ebc4d250c999c1d1de595a31456bc84e9d1530c472933fb3c8519ba1151ba5